How do I put a Status ProX device into pairing mode?
Answer
Power the Status ProX on, then use its pairing button sequence from the manual—often a long-press until the LED flashes a pairing pattern. Turn Bluetooth on in the phone, keep the devices close, and forget any old Status ProX Bluetooth entry before retrying.

Follow these steps
Clear old Bluetooth bonds
On the phone, go to Bluetooth settings, forget any existing Status ProX entry, and disable Bluetooth on other nearby phones that may auto-reconnect.
You should see: No stale ProX bond remains on the phone you will use.
Enter pairing mode
Power on the ProX and long-press the pairing control until the LED shows the pairing flash pattern described in the manual.
You should see: The LED indicates pairing/discoverable mode.
Connect from the phone
Open the official app or system Bluetooth scan and select Status ProX while it is flashing.
You should see: The phone connects and the LED changes to a connected state.
Retry with a reboot
If pairing fails, reboot the phone, power-cycle the ProX, and repeat the pairing-mode long-press once more.
You should see: Pairing completes on the second attempt.

Extra tips
What to look for: A flashing pairing LED pattern, Bluetooth listing for Status ProX, and whether another phone still holds the connection.
Before you change anything: Charge the Status ProX. Install the official companion app if required. Turn off battery saver that kills Bluetooth scanning. Keep the phone within a few feet during pairing.
